Edition 2025 — Aria Consapevole
The second edition of the Aria Consapevole Festival was held on July 5 and 6, 2025, in Piazza San Pietro in Galatina, under the artistic direction of Stefano Rizzelli. The opening evening on July 5 brought great folk music to the square with Eugenio Bennato and Tony Esposito, accompanied by a folk orchestra, and saw the presentation of Sona Taranta, a manifesto song blending Salento tradition with electronic experimentation. During the event, the Cuore di Tufo and Donna Taranta awards were presented. The day of July 6 was dedicated to the Super Talk Essere Tarantata (Being a Tarantata), inspired by the studies of Ernesto De Martino and hosted at the Palazzo della Cultura. An edition that reaffirmed Galatina's role as the heart of tarantism and its bid for Italian Capital of Culture 2028.
Programme
Saturday, July 5, 2025 — Piazza San Pietro
- Folk music concert with Eugenio Bennato and Tony Esposito, accompanied by a folk orchestra.
- Presentation of the song Sona Taranta by Collettivo A Sud, a new anthem blending pizzica and electronic experimentation.
- Presentation of the Cuore di Tufo (to Giovanni Russo) and Donna Taranta (to Corrado Marra) awards.
Sunday, July 6, 2025 — Palazzo della Cultura
- Super Talk Essere Tarantata, a round table inspired by Ernesto De Martino's essay, with contributions from scholars and cultural figures, including Eugenio Imbriani, Davide Rondoni, Flaminia Bolzan, Marina Pierri, and Noel Gazzano.
